The Philadelphia Phillies ended April by blowing a 4-0 lead to the last place Chicago Cubs on April 30. Fortunately, Phillies fans like myself were kept at bay when Placido Polanco had a game-winning two-run double in the eighth inning anyway. However, the 6-4 victory doesn’t hide how Philadelphia nearly lost three of four games to a poor team at home, after splitting four games to the equally poor San Diego Padres the previous weekend.
